Admissions Overview

Alvernia University is moderately selective with a 59% acceptance rate, meaning about 6 out of 10 applicants get accepted. The middle 50% of students score between 996 and 1170 on the SAT, with an average of 1083. This puts most admitted students in the solid B-student range rather than requiring top grades. As a Catholic university founded in 1958, Alvernia looks for students who value small class sizes (12:1 student-faculty ratio) and want personal attention from professors. The school attracts students interested in health sciences, business, and education who appreciate a faith-based environment but don't need perfect test scores to succeed.
